Alonso shades Schu in 2nd session
![]() Alonso shaded Schumacher in the afternoon session at Nuerburgring NUERBURGRING, Germany -- World champion Fernando Alonso beat Michael Schumacher by a fraction in Friday practice, promising another thrilling duel at the European Formula One Grand Prix. Renault driver Alonso did not set a time in the morning session but clocked one minute 33.579 in the afternoon on the 5.148-km Nuerburgring in Germany. Ferrari's Schumacher set 1:33.619 in front of a home crowd, with brother Ralf in a Toyota the next best 'race' driver in sixth place with 1:33.883 minutes. Williams test driver Alexander Wurz led the way with 1:32.675 with other test drivers Robert Doornbos (Red Bull) and Anthony Davidson (Honda) sandwiched between the Schumacher brothers in fourth and fifth place. The test drivers are only eligible to compete on Friday at a GP weekend. Seven-time world champion Schumacher beat Alonso two weeks ago in Imola, Italy and another duel between the two stars looms for Saturday qualifying and Sunday's race. Alonso leads the drivers standings with 36 points from four races ahead of Schumacher (21) and McLaren-Mercedes driver Kimi Raikkonen who has 18. Raikkonen, who had to retire with a flat tyre in leading position in the final lap of last year's race then won by Alonso, was 13th on Friday afternoon in 1:34.536. The day's fastest time of 1:32.079 minutes came from test driver Wurz in the morning session, with the four-time Nuerburgring winner Schumacher the best among those will will line-up on the starting grid, on 1:32.858 minutes.
